Output 539abf1409953f4e3193c3ae01ac76699184629c73d068c81fce4d2915962ddb:0

value
17328382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e3ab2d59deaebade220d55e4bd15c1a6e025fed OP_EQUAL
address
MF2oFqkCnszq78Vu9idP381A1ve8grqFPG
transaction
539abf1409953f4e3193c3ae01ac76699184629c73d068c81fce4d2915962ddb
spent
true